What Type A and Type B mean
Type A
Violations of licensing requirements that, if not corrected, have a direct and immediate risk to the health, safety, or personal rights of persons in care.
Type B
Violations of licensing requirements that, without correction, could become a risk to the health, safety, or personal rights of persons in care.

Both classifications are published by California CDSS and are shown as published. SeniorLivingFacts does not rename them or add a severity level of its own.

Inspection
Hazardous items and storageType B
Official classification
Type B
Official code
87309(a)
Regulation authority
CCR

What the official deficiency says

(a) Disinfectants, cleaning solutions, poisons, firearms and other items which could pose a danger if readily available to clients shall be stored where inaccessible to clients.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Deficient Practice Statement Based on LPA observ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in 2 out of 2 cleaning supplies found in unsecured staff bathroom which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

Official plan of correction

POC Due Date: 03/10/2022 Plan of Correction Licensee failed to ensure disinfectants and cleaning solutions that could pose a danger if readily available to clients were stored in a secured location. Licensee immediately removed cleaning products and locked staff bathroom. Licensee conducted coaching with all staff to ensure facility will remain in compliance. POC cleared during the time of visit.

Official record says corrected or clearedOn or before Mar 10, 2022
